Beam end reinforcement (79)

Beam end reinforcement (79) creates reinforcement for the end of a concrete beam or strip footing.

Bars created

  • Horizontal U-shaped bars (types 1 and 2)

  • Vertical U-shaped bars (types 3A and 3B)

  • Oblique bar (type 4)

  • Stirrups (types 5A and 5B)

Do not use for

Parts that have irregular cross sections.

Before you start

  • Create the concrete beam or strip footing.

  • Calculate the required area of reinforcement.

Picking order

  1. Select concrete beam or strip footing.

  2. Pick position.

Picture tab

Use the Picture tab to define concrete cover thickness, distances from the concrete surface to the bars, and angle of bar 4.

Bars tab

Use the Bars tab to define which bars to create, bar dimensions, and to slice bars 3A and 3B.

Horizontal U bars 1 and 2

Use the following options to create bars in the lower area of the beam end, in the horizontal planes (bar type 1):

To create bars in the upper area of the beam end, around a hole, enter dimensions for bar 2.

Vertical U bars 3A and 3B

To create vertical U-shaped bars, enter dimensions for:

  • Bar 3A: for the notched area of the beam.

  • Bar 3B: for the higher part of the beam.

Splicing bars 3

You can create vertical U bars (bar type 3) of two bars joined with a splice. To do this, use the following list box on the Bars tab:

If you choose to splice bars, you can select the splice type:

Lap up

Creates a lap splice above the horizontal center line of the beam end.

Lap down

Creates a lap splice below the horizontal center line of the beam end.

Lap both

Creates a lap splice centered to the horizontal center line of the beam end.

Coupler

Creates a coupler.

Weld joint

Creates a welded joint.

For lap splices, you can define the lap length L and whether the bars are on top of each other or parallel to each other.

For all splice types, you can define the offset of the splice center point from the horizontal center line of the beam end.

Stirrups 5A and 5B

To create stirrups for beam ends, enter dimensions for:

  • Bar 5A: for the notched area of the beam.

  • Bar 5B: for the higher part of the beam.

Groups tab

Use the Groups tab to define grouping properties of bars.

Enter the number and spacing of bars in each group of bar types. If the spacing varies, enter each value individually.
